Odisha Subordinate Staff Selection Commission (OSSSC) has released a short notification — Advertisement No. IIE-54/2026-1896 dated 11 June 2026 — announcing one of the largest single-post healthcare recruitments in Odisha's history: 5,989 Nursing Officer (Group-C) vacancies under the Health & Family Welfare Department, Government of Odisha. These are District Cadre posts — meaning selected candidates will be posted and transferred only within the district they are recruited for, across all 30 district establishments under the respective Chief District Medical & Public Health Officers (CDM & PHOs). Candidates holding GNM (General Nursing and Midwifery) Diploma or B.Sc. Nursing degree from an INC-recognised institution, along with a valid registration from the Odisha Nursing Council (or any State Nursing Council recognised by the Nursing Council of India), and proficiency in Odia language (Class 7 and above), can apply online from 13 June 2026. Last date: 13 July 2026. Selection via OMR-based Written Examination (100 MCQs, 100 marks, 2 hours) followed by Document Verification. Pay Scale: ₹29,200 – ₹92,300 per month (Pay Level-8, 7th CPC).
Odia Language Proficiency — Non-Negotiable Requirement for All Candidates
This is a state government recruitment under the Government of Odisha. All candidates — whether from Odisha or from other states — must have passed Odia as a language subject at Class 7 standard or above from a recognised Board. This is a mandatory eligibility condition, not a qualifying test. Candidates who have not studied Odia as a subject at school must obtain an equivalent Odia language certificate from a recognised institution before applying. Additionally, selected candidates must be able to read and write Odia fluently — a critical requirement for communicating with patients and documenting records in Odisha's district healthcare facilities.

Nursing Officer — District Cadre, Group-C | Health & Family Welfare Department
These posts are placed under the administrative control of the respective Chief District Medical & Public Health Officers (CDM & PHOs) across all 30 districts. Selected candidates work in government health facilities — PHCs, CHCs, District Hospitals, and other public health establishments within their district. This is a permanent state government position with full service benefits under the Odisha Government.

Being a District Cadre post means your job is tied to a specific district of Odisha. You will be posted in government health institutions — Primary Health Centres (PHCs), Community Health Centres (CHCs), Sub-Divisional Hospitals, and District Hospitals — within the district you select during application. Transfers can only happen within the same district. This provides geographic stability but requires candidates to be genuinely willing to serve in the district of their choice. In the online application, you will indicate your preferred district — OSSSC prepares separate district-wise merit lists accordingly.

Core Nursing Syllabus — Covering the 60-Mark Nursing Domain Section
With 60 marks dedicated to nursing subjects, core clinical knowledge is the key differentiator in this exam. Candidates should focus on: (1) Anatomy & Physiology — body systems and their functions; (2) Medical-Surgical Nursing — common conditions, nursing interventions, and patient care; (3) Community Health Nursing — PHC operations, immunisation schedules, national health programmes in Odisha; (4) Pharmacology — drug classifications, calculations, and commonly used medications. The remaining 40 marks cover General Knowledge (focus on Odisha geography, history, Chief Ministers, health schemes, national programmes) and Odia language (grammar, comprehension, vocabulary). With 0.25 negative marking, avoid random guessing — attempt only confident answers.

OSSSC uses a One-Time Registration (OTR) system — every candidate must complete OTR once on osssc.gov.in. If you have already completed OTR for any previous OSSSC recruitment (Forester, RI, etc.), the same OTR credentials can be used to apply for this Nursing Officer post. OTR involves creating a permanent profile with your personal details, educational qualifications, and photograph/signature — this profile is linked to your Aadhaar number. OTR registration closes on 06 July 2026 — candidates must complete OTR before this date, even if the application deadline is 13 July 2026.
Step 1 — Complete OTR (One-Time Registration) at osssc.gov.in
Visit www.osssc.gov.in → Click on One-Time Registration (OTR) on the homepage → If already registered, skip to Step 2. For new registration: enter your Aadhaar number, verify with OTP, fill complete personal details (name, DOB, gender, category, contact details), upload passport-size photograph (JPG, 20–50 KB) and scanned signature (JPG, 20–50 KB). Your OTR profile is permanent and linked to all future OSSSC applications. After OTR, save your Registration ID and password securely.
Step 2 — Login and Find the Nursing Officer Advertisement
After OTR, log in to your OSSSC account using your OTR credentials. On the dashboard, locate Advertisement No. IIE-54/2026-1896 — Nursing Officer Recruitment 2026. Click on Apply Now. Your OTR-linked personal details will auto-populate in the application form. Verify all auto-filled information carefully — if any discrepancy exists in your OTR profile (name mismatch, wrong DOB), rectify it at the OTR level before proceeding.
Step 3 — Fill Application Details & Select Preferred District
Complete all application-specific fields: (a) Nursing qualification details — GNM or B.Sc. Nursing — institution name, year of passing, marks obtained, whether INC-recognised; (b) Nursing Council Registration details — registration number, issuing council (Odisha/State), validity date; (c) Odia language proof — class at which Odia was studied, Board name, year; (d) Preferred district selection — choose carefully, as district-wise merit lists are prepared separately — preference cannot usually be changed after submission; (e) Category details — SC/ST/SEBC/EWS/PwD/ExSM as applicable with certificate number.
Step 4 — Upload Required Documents
Upload scanned copies: (a) Valid Nursing Council Registration Certificate — this is the most critical upload — must show current validity and registered name matching application; (b) GNM marksheets/certificate or B.Sc. Nursing marksheets/degree certificate — all years/semesters; (c) 10+2 (HSC) certificate and marksheet; (d) Category certificate if applicable — SC/ST/SEBC/EWS/PwD — in Odisha Government prescribed format; (e) Odia language proof (school certificate showing Odia as subject); (f) any additional documents specified in the detailed notification. All uploads must be in the specified format and file size.
Step 5 — Pay Application Fee & Submit
Pay the prescribed application fee (amount specified in detailed notification — typically ₹100–₹200 for General/SEBC/EWS; Nil for SC/ST/PwD/Women — verify in the official detailed notification). Payment through the OSSSC payment gateway via Debit Card, Credit Card, or Net Banking. After payment, review the complete application preview. Click Final Submit. Download and save the application confirmation with your Application Reference Number. Submit before 13 July 2026 — the system closes at midnight on the last date.
